You can access the patch from: http://lists.mysql.com/commits/14277 ChangeSet@1.2284, 2006-10-24 18:33:32+03:00, gkodinov@macbook.gmz +4 -0 Bug #23184: SELECT causes server crash Item::val_xxx() may be called by the server several times at execute time for a single query. Calls to val_xxx() may be very expensive and sometimes (count(distinct), sum(distinct), avg(distinct)) not possible. To avoid that problem the results of calculation for these aggregate functions are cached so that val_xxx() methods just return the calculated value for the second and subsequent calls.

Paul DuBois
Noted in 5.0.32, 5.1.14 changelogs. Calculation of COUNT(DISTINCT), AVG(DISTINCT), or SUM(DISTINCT) when they are referenced more than once in a single query with GROUP BY could cause a server crash.
